Responsibilities
* Participates in the conceptual engineering development of capital projects
* Develops project descriptions, budgets, cost estimates, schedules, and justifications
* Assists operations with capital budget requests, selection, and approval
* Develops and submits capital budget requests where needed
* Creates requests for proposals, bid documents, specifications, and contracts
* Evaluates construction, equipment, and service bids and coordinates the selection of successful bidders
Coordinates permits for projects
* Coordinates technical studies, surveys & site inspections
* Mentors and manages less senior engineers and project managers
* Works closely with vendors, equipment suppliers, contractors, engineers, and plant personnel in the planning and execution of projects
* Manages overall project activities and coordinates members of the project team
* Works closely with purchasing to generate purchase requisitions
* Controls project costs by approving expenditures and tracking actual vs. budget costs
* Controls project schedules; coordinates project meetings
* Creates status reports with activity, budget, and schedule updates
* Manages construction activities as needed
* Ensures that projects are executed safely per prevailing safety standards, environmental requirements, and CPC requirements
* Ensures that projects meet goals, specifications, quality, budget, schedule, and performance guarantees
* Provides technical expertise in their engineering discipline
